In collaboration with Visa, Ripio Card enables individuals to make 5% cashback in bitcoin on all pre-paid acquisitions throughout the globe till October 31. Ripio, a cryptocurrency provider, has actually introduced the pre-paid Ripio Card for Brazil in collaboration with Visa, per a record from Site do Bitcoin. Customers of the Ripio Card can get as much as 5% cashback in bitcoin with any kind of acquisition. When the card is made use of, Ripio will immediately transform bitcoin made use of for an acquisition to the Brazilian Actual ($ R). This conversion enables the Visa network to refine the purchase in fiat in behalf of Ripio, providing reals to the seller. In addition, bitcoin cashback is restricted to R$ 250 each month as well as will certainly not be attributed after October 31. In addition, individuals of the Ripio Card will certainly have the ability to invest their bitcoin anywhere throughout the globe that sustains Visa deals without experiencing any kind of costs. “” The 5% cashback in BTC is an outstanding return device for individuals as well as absolutely much above the choices provided by standard banks,”” stated Sebastian Serrano, Chief Executive Officer of Ripio. Henrique Teixeira, Ripio'’s worldwide head of brand-new company, anticipates 250,000 individuals will certainly be leveraging the pre-paid card by December later on this year. Hence, in order to achieve the required range for the system, Teixeira anticipates that the firm will certainly invest near R$ 1.5 million on the brand-new item. Ripio is signing up with an expanding listing of business as well as organizations broadening bitcoin offerings to Brazil, as the nation flaunts a a great deal of bitcoin financiers. Actually, Brazil placed 14th on a leading 20 listing of nations with the highest degree of cryptocurrency fostering, while additionally ranking 5th for overall on-chain worth sent out. Hence, financial titans Santander as well as BTG Pactual, broker agent leviathan XP, as well as Warren Buffet-backed NuBank have actually all pressed to get in the expanding community, to name a few.
